What is ImageBrowserForm.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by multiple programs at the same time. Think of it like a library that different software programs can go to in order to borrow pieces of code they need to run. The ImageBrowserForm.dll is a specific DLL file that is important for the software Check Designer.

This DLL file provides the functionality for handling image browsing within the Check Designer software. It allows Check Designer to display and manage images within its interface, making it an essential component for the software to work properly. Without ImageBrowserForm.dll, Check Designer may not be able to display images or perform image-related functions.

D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.

  • This application failed to start because ImageBrowserForm.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error message is a sign that a DLL file that the application relies on is not present in the system. Reinstalling the application may install the missing DLL file and fix the problem.
  • ImageBrowserForm.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message implies that there could be an error within the DLL file, or the DLL is not compatible with the Windows version you're running. This could occur if there's a mismatch between the DLL file and the Windows version or system architecture.
  • The file ImageBrowserForm.dll is missing: This suggests that a DLL file required for certain functionalities is not available in your system. This could have occurred due to manual deletion, system restore, or a recent software uninstallation.
  • Cannot register ImageBrowserForm.dll: This suggests that the DLL file could not be registered by the system, possibly due to inconsistencies or errors in the Windows Registry. Another reason might be that the DLL file is not in the correct directory or is missing.
  • ImageBrowserForm.dll not found: This indicates that the application you're trying to run is looking for a specific DLL file that it can't locate. This could be due to the DLL file being missing, corrupted, or incorrectly installed.

Perform a Repair Install of Windows

Step 1: Create a Windows 10 Installation Media

Step 1: Create a Windows 10 Installation Media Thumbnail
  1. Go to the Microsoft website and download the Windows 10 Media Creation Tool.

  2. Run the tool and select Create installation media for another PC.

  3. Follow the prompts to create a bootable USB drive or ISO file.

Step 2: Start the Repair Install

Step 2: Start the Repair Install Thumbnail
  1. Insert the Windows 10 installation media you created into your PC and run setup.exe.

  2. Follow the prompts until you get to the Ready to install screen.

Step 3: Choose the Right Install Option

Step 3: Choose the Right Install Option Thumbnail
  1. On the Ready to install screen, make sure Keep personal files and apps is selected.

  2. Click Install to start the repair install.

Step 4: Complete the Installation

Step 4: Complete the Installation Thumbnail
  1. Your computer will restart several times during the installation. Make sure not to turn off your computer during this process.

Step 5: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 5: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the installation, check if the ImageBrowserForm.dll problem persists.
